There's also the issue of quarterback Jayden Daniels and whether he'll play for SNF. 

We won't know if he's in or out until later in the week, but I don't expect him to play. His hamstring ailment is being compared to that of Baltimore Ravens QB Lamar Jackson. Again, it's too early to know for sure, but if Daniels can't play, the Seahawks will become larger favorites. 

Seattle is 3-0 on the road, with a margin of victory of 8.3 points. They are 2-0 as the road betting favorite, will be well-rested coming off a bye week and have the second-best defensive DVOA and seventh-best offensive DVOA. 

The Commanders, have struggled defensively, conceding at least 336 total yards in six successive games. And if Daniels doesn't play, the Seahawks will have the decisive advantage on both sides of the ball.
